Fab Jab Pop-up Vaccination Clinic at the Pride Centre

Fab Jab image

The Victorian Pride Centre is working with a variety of respected organisations, including Star Health, to promote vaccinations to LGBTIQ+ communities through a pop-up COVID-19 vaccination clinic from Monday 18 October to Sunday 24 October. The Fab Jab drive is focused on providing safe and welcoming spaces for LGBTIQ+ communities in which to get vaccinated.

A range of LGBTIQ+ organisations across the state are taking part in this initiative as ambassadors, including – Vincent Care, Switchboard, JOY Media, Thorne Harbour Health, Niche, Your Community Health, Drummond Street Services, and Transgender Victoria.

The pop-up clinic at the Centre on Fitzroy Street, St. Kilda, will be focused on offering vaccination services to members of LGBTIQ+ communities from a variety of backgrounds in a safe and inclusive environment. This vital service will be supported by Pride Centre volunteers, who will welcome and guide attendees through their visit.
